Richard Allain: Manger Tom (Melody Instruments)

A delightful Christmas cantata for children?s voices (and ensemble/electronic backing tracks), with or without narrator: reggae, jazz, rock ballad and pop numbers to witty text by Richard and Thomas Allain.Caesar has called a census in the Holy Land. So everyone is crowding back into Bethlehem, a town where they read Shalom! Magazine, where suddenly there are donkey traffic gridlocks and hotels where you can't get a room for love or shekels.Tom works doing odd jobs at the Fun Big Inn, which isn't much fun at all. This busy night, he decides to leave the landlord in the lurch and head for the bright lights of Jerusalem. But he doesn't get far, running first into reggae singing shepherds and then three groovy wise dudes following a star. Tom can hardly ignore the remarkable things they have to tell him. So what does he do next? What would any of us do?Richard and Thomas Allain retell the story of the Nativity in a new and individual way, with immediacy and wit, in a string of unforgettable tuneful songs and sharply clever words in an idiom accessible to everyone.Manger Tom can be performed with unison voices, someone to narrate, highly effective with just Piano or Keyboard accompaniment. But there are parts available too, for instruments you might want to add. Included with the score of Manger Tom is a CD which comprises of a full performance of the musical numbers by professional singers and players, as well as just the accompaniments for everyone to sing along to, if they prefer.Additionally, lyric sheets and a script are available as free downloads - visit www.hybridpublications.com to access the bonus material. Lyric sheets enable easy rehearsals and the script allows Manger Tom to be performed as a full nativity play.Contains parts for Eb, Bb and C instruments.Review from Andrew Stewart of Classroom Music says: "Manger Tom manages to squeeze within the space of eight numbers everything from big-band and rock numbers to reggae and, in ?Star of the Show?, the essence of a contemporary worship song.""Manger Tom scores exemplary marks in the revitalisation and excellence departments. Its big-hearted showtunes are pitched at a level of invention clearly intended to challenge and engage young performers."

Thea Musgrave: Largo, In Homage to B.A.C.H. For String Orchestra (5.4.3.2.1 players)

Largo, In Homage to B.A.C.H. was commissioned by the Carmel Bach Festival 2013, and Music Director Paul Goodwin to whom the work is dedicated. COMPOSER NOTE: My very first idea was to use the BACH initials as a basis for the work - not as the melodic motif often used by composers, but rather as a harmonic structure. This is possible because in the German musical tradition, B stands for B flat and H for B natural. This led to the thought that there would be four short sections, each led by a different soloist, forming an emotional journey: Lamentoso (mournful), Ardente (fervent), Inquieto (restless) and Sereno (peaceful). The Double Bass leads the first section, B. Lamentoso (B flat major). The Cello leads the next, A. Ardente (A major), faster and higher in pitch to reflect the change of mood, and when the Viola soloist urgently interrupts in C. Inquieto (C major), the scene is set for a big climax. In the final section, H. Sereno (B minor), the mood, persuaded by the Violin soloist, quietens and eventually leads to a brief quote from the famous chorale from the St. Matthew Passion, O Haupt voll Blut und Wunden which ends the work, in calm and peace, with a 'tierce de Picardie'. In turn, each soloist carries the linear activity as protagonist on this emotional journey, and the accompaniment to each section is dominated by the ?tonality? indicated. But there is also a mysterious ?misty? overlay, only dissipating after the Viola?s tempestuous climax. The cluster of notes that makes up this ?mist? is formed from the octatonic scale, in each case incorporating notes of the triad of the relative section to determine its tonality (B flat major, C major etc). Each section therefore uses only the notes of the octatonic scale1 associated with it - until the Viola begins to incorporate a chromatic scale2 - and it is only in the final section that the familiar diatonic scale 3 appears and the mist is dissipated. Therefore, although the overall feeling of the four sections alters to travel spontaneously and 'organically' through the arc of the piece, each section (B.A.C.H.) is rigorously organised and controlled with similar internal ingredients as well as within a "master plan." This, for me, is the essence of Bach.

Craig McLeish: A Gaelic Blessing (Novello New Choral Series)

A Gaelic Blessing is a simple and catchy piece by Craig McLeish. This piece will be particularly useful for school, junior and community choirs, and a tuneful introduction to singing simple contrapuntal lines.The second soprano part repeats the tune at bar 33 and should dominate here; the first sopranos and altos should support appropriately. Ease and beauty of tone should be of paramount importance throughout.An inspiring selection of new works from a range of contemporary composers, the Novello New Choral Series offers pieces for all types of choirs, including sacred and secular works from simple, four-part settings to more expansive, yet accessible, repertoire in an exciting variety of styles.Craig McLeish began his musical life as a chorister at St Paul?s Cathedral under Barry Rose. He began composing at the age of ten and his preces and responses for four trebles are still in the repertoire. After a degree at York University he returned to London to study at the Guildhall and sang again at St Paul?s as a tenor. At the time he also arranged and copied music for West End shows such as Les Miserables and Miss Saigon, and played bass guitar for various groups. This led to a spell in the cult pop band ?Fat & Frantic?, who shaved the top 100 twice with the whimsical anthem Last night my wife hoovered my head. He also worked as musical assistant for David Heneker (Half a Sixpence) and David Fanshawe (African Sanctus).In 1992 Craig became director of the Methodist Association of Youth Clubs Orchestra and Singers, performing concerts throughout the UK and becoming involved in a number of recordings and BBC broadcasts. During this time he arranged more than 250 orchestral scores ranging from Queen to Calamity Jane, Stravinsky and Stevie Wonder. Alongside this he began arranging and writing songs for children?s collections (Big Blue Planet, Love Shone Down) and producing recordings and string arrangements for various artists (Sheila Walsh, Kim Hill, Matt Redman). He is also well known as a conductor and arranger for Songs of Praise.Recently Craig has collaborated with composer Tolga Kashif writing orchestrations for the RPO?s Seo Taiji Symphony, the Classic FM chart-topping CD by saxophonist Tyler Rix, and the Genesis Suite which was premiered at the Barbican. He has been musical director of Young Voices UK for 13 years, bringing large school choirs together to play with a live band and solo artists, and currently conducts the Milton Keynes Community Choir, Hart and Soul Community Choir and the Milton Keynes Youth Choir.
